2. Be careful when eating meat or eggs. Avoid having raw or uncooked meat, seafood and poultry. Cook the food to kill the bacteria (Salmonella). Undercooked food especially poultry, chicken, turkey meat and seafood such as oysters can lead to miscarriage.

3. Listeria is a bacteria which can cause miscarriage at any stage of pregnancy. Uncooked meat or chicken, seafood, unpasteurized cheese, milk or dairy products have large amount of listeria.

4. Avoid imported soft cheese such as Brie, feta, Camembert, Roquefort, blue-veined, Gorgonzola, etc as these are mainly made with unpasteurized milk which can be harmful during pregnancy.
